Course Overview
This course reviews current BCWWA test procedures preparing students to write for cross connection control recertification. The BCWWA recertification examination will take place at BCIT. Student contact hours consist of 12 hours of instruction and a 6 hour exam. To confirm eligibility contact the BCWWA at 604-433-4389. Learning Outcomes
Upon successful completion of this course, the student will be able to:
Test and troubleshoot reduced pressure backflow assembly.
- Test and troubleshoot double check valve assembly.
- Test and troubleshoot pressure vacuum breaker assembly.
- On successful completion student will achieve recertification for a further 3 year period.
